Output 89ab60579601752099f9c125ac68a76218063291e7c98bc82fd04daba5a2d319:1

value
245030
script pubkey
OP_0 OP_PUSHBYTES_20 bba358fd02174f201e2f72df379853fdec5d075e
address
ltc1qhw343lgzza8jq830wt0n0xznlhk96p675ey6f2
transaction
89ab60579601752099f9c125ac68a76218063291e7c98bc82fd04daba5a2d319
spent
true